Corpus Christi, Texas app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 5,400 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Corpus Christi —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Corpus Christi practice location on file.
The provider mix in Corpus Christi is weighted toward Behavior Technician (356 clinicians, followed by Family Nurse Practitioner with 346 and Student in an Organized Health Care Education/Training Program with 269).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
